JAK (Janus kinase) inhibitors are compounds that target the JAK-STAT signaling pathway, which is involved in cell growth, immune response, and angiogenesis. By inhibiting JAK, these compounds can reduce the signaling that leads to the formation of new blood vessels in tumors, thereby inhibiting tumor growth. JAK inhibitors are important in the treatment of cancers and inflammatory diseases.
